The prediction was based on dataset comprised from the following descriptors: "Gene mutation"
Estimation method: Taking highest mode value from the 5 nearest neighbours
Domain logical expression:Result: In Domain

((("a" and "b" ) and ("c" and ( not "d") ) ) and ("e" and "f" ) )

Domain logical expression index: "a"

Similarity boundary:Target: c1(S(=O)(=O)O)c(N)cc(S(=O)(=O)O)cc1
Threshold=50%,
Dice(Atom pairs)

Domain logical expression index: "b"

Similarity boundary:Target: c1(S(=O)(=O)O)c(N)cc(S(=O)(=O)O)cc1
Threshold=60%,
Dice(Atom pairs)

Domain logical expression index: "c"

Referential boundary: The target chemical should be classified as No alert found by DNA binding by OECD

Domain logical expression index: "d"

Referential boundary: The target chemical should be classified as Alkyl phenols OR Aromatic nitro OR Epoxides OR MA: Direct Acting Epoxides and related OR MA: Nitrenium Ion Formation OR MA: P450 Mediated Activation to Quinones and Quinone-type Chemicals OR Mechanistic Domain: Michael addition OR Mechanistic Domain: SN1 OR Mechanistic Domain: SN2 by DNA binding by OECD

Domain logical expression index: "e"

Parametric boundary:The target chemical should have a value of log Kow which is >= -3.55

Domain logical expression index: "f"

Parametric boundary:The target chemical should have a value of log Kow which is <= -2.18

Applicant's summary and conclusion

Conclusions:
Interpretation of results (migrated information):
negative
Executive summary:

2-aminobenzene-1,4-disulphonic acid will have no genetic toxicity effect as per QSAR prediction.
